提交 c32940a6 编写于 作者: M Mauro Carvalho Chehab

doc-rst: planar-apis: fix some conversion troubles

There is a missing escape caracter, causing troubles at the
format of one of the paragraphs. Also, the ioctl description
was producing some warnings about wrong identation.
Signed-off-by: NMauro Carvalho Chehab <mchehab@s-opensource.com>
上级 b7e67f6c
...@@ -20,7 +20,7 @@ Some of the V4L2 API calls and structures are interpreted differently, ...@@ -20,7 +20,7 @@ Some of the V4L2 API calls and structures are interpreted differently,
depending on whether single- or multi-planar API is being used. An depending on whether single- or multi-planar API is being used. An
application can choose whether to use one or the other by passing a application can choose whether to use one or the other by passing a
corresponding buffer type to its ioctl calls. Multi-planar versions of corresponding buffer type to its ioctl calls. Multi-planar versions of
buffer types are suffixed with an `_MPLANE' string. For a list of buffer types are suffixed with an ``_MPLANE`` string. For a list of
available multi-planar buffer types see enum available multi-planar buffer types see enum
:ref:`v4l2_buf_type <v4l2-buf-type>`. :ref:`v4l2_buf_type <v4l2-buf-type>`.
...@@ -39,29 +39,25 @@ handle multi-planar formats. ...@@ -39,29 +39,25 @@ handle multi-planar formats.
Calls that distinguish between single and multi-planar APIs Calls that distinguish between single and multi-planar APIs
=========================================================== ===========================================================
:ref:`VIDIOC_QUERYCAP` :ref:`VIDIOC_QUERYCAP <VIDIOC_QUERYCAP>`
Two additional multi-planar capabilities are added. They can be set Two additional multi-planar capabilities are added. They can be set
together with non-multi-planar ones for devices that handle both together with non-multi-planar ones for devices that handle both
single- and multi-planar formats. single- and multi-planar formats.
:ref:`VIDIOC_G_FMT <VIDIOC_G_FMT>`, :ref:`VIDIOC_G_FMT <VIDIOC_G_FMT>`, :ref:`VIDIOC_S_FMT <VIDIOC_G_FMT>`, :ref:`VIDIOC_TRY_FMT <VIDIOC_G_FMT>`
:ref:`VIDIOC_S_FMT <VIDIOC_G_FMT>`,
:ref:`VIDIOC_TRY_FMT <VIDIOC_G_FMT>`
New structures for describing multi-planar formats are added: struct New structures for describing multi-planar formats are added: struct
:ref:`v4l2_pix_format_mplane <v4l2-pix-format-mplane>` and :ref:`v4l2_pix_format_mplane <v4l2-pix-format-mplane>` and
struct :ref:`v4l2_plane_pix_format <v4l2-plane-pix-format>`. struct :ref:`v4l2_plane_pix_format <v4l2-plane-pix-format>`.
Drivers may define new multi-planar formats, which have distinct Drivers may define new multi-planar formats, which have distinct
FourCC codes from the existing single-planar ones. FourCC codes from the existing single-planar ones.
:ref:`VIDIOC_QBUF`, :ref:`VIDIOC_QBUF <VIDIOC_QBUF>`, :ref:`VIDIOC_DQBUF <VIDIOC_QBUF>`, :ref:`VIDIOC_QUERYBUF <VIDIOC_QUERYBUF>`
:ref:`VIDIOC_DQBUF <VIDIOC_QBUF>`,
:ref:`VIDIOC_QUERYBUF`
A new struct :ref:`v4l2_plane <v4l2-plane>` structure for A new struct :ref:`v4l2_plane <v4l2-plane>` structure for
describing planes is added. Arrays of this structure are passed in describing planes is added. Arrays of this structure are passed in
the new ``m.planes`` field of struct the new ``m.planes`` field of struct
:ref:`v4l2_buffer <v4l2-buffer>`. :ref:`v4l2_buffer <v4l2-buffer>`.
:ref:`VIDIOC_REQBUFS` :ref:`VIDIOC_REQBUFS <VIDIOC_REQBUFS>`
Will allocate multi-planar buffers as requested. Will allocate multi-planar buffers as requested.
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册